Additional Details:
The Delaware river bridge, the largest suspension bridge in the world, connecting Philadelphia, Pa. and Camden, N.J., with a single span 1750 ft. long, center to center of main piers, with a clearance above high water of 135 ft. over a width of 800 ft. in center of span. The main structure is of a 2-cable suspension type, carrying a roadway for 6 lines of vehicles, 2 lines of surface cars, 2 lines for rapid transit and 2 ten foot sidewalks above the roadway. The cost is about $29,000,000 and was completed in 1926, in time for the sequin-centennial held in Philadelphia during that year.
